Output 59bbc33d25f17d94b8dd6a0dbe4c4e164e5d1a5ac230d1af151136c1ae659c28:1

value
3288379259722
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1fc1ef20b3c3f48fa2d55bd22c7357f1de9109cf OP_EQUALVERIFY OP_CHECKSIG
address
D831oyvHpm8xgez1j5UeLRJ7f7r6875X12
transaction
59bbc33d25f17d94b8dd6a0dbe4c4e164e5d1a5ac230d1af151136c1ae659c28